首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么URLConnection inputStream返回"Busy“?

URLConnection是Java中用于创建HTTP连接的类。当调用URLConnection的getInputStream()方法时,可能会返回"Busy"的错误信息。

返回"Busy"的原因可能有以下几种情况:

  1. 服务器过载:当服务器负载过高或处理请求的线程不足时,服务器可能会返回"Busy"的错误信息。这通常是由于服务器资源不足导致的,例如处理大量并发请求或者执行复杂的计算任务。
  2. 网络连接问题:如果网络连接不稳定或者出现丢包等问题,可能会导致URLConnection的getInputStream()方法返回"Busy"。这可能是由于网络传输过程中的错误导致的,例如连接超时、DNS解析失败或者网络丢包。
  3. 防火墙或代理问题:某些网络环境下,防火墙或代理服务器可能会阻止URLConnection的请求,导致返回"Busy"。这可能是由于网络安全策略或者代理配置不正确导致的。

解决该问题的方法如下:

  1. 重试请求:由于返回"Busy"通常是临时性的问题,可以尝试多次请求,增加重试机制。可以使用循环来不断尝试,直到请求成功为止。
  2. 检查服务器负载:如果是服务器过载导致的问题,可以联系服务器管理员或者运维团队,确认服务器负载情况,并调整服务器资源配置以满足需求。
  3. 检查网络连接:检查网络连接是否正常,可以尝试使用其他网络环境或者重新连接网络。如果发现网络连接存在问题,可以联系网络管理员或者运营商进行修复。
  4. 检查防火墙或代理配置:如果使用了防火墙或代理服务器,确保配置正确,并且允许URLConnection的请求通过。可以联系网络管理员或者运维团队进行相关配置调整。

请注意,答案中没有提及具体的腾讯云产品或者链接地址,因为题目要求不涉及云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 爬虫其实很简单!——网络爬虫快速实现(一)

    今天我来带领大家一起学习编写一个网络爬虫!其实爬虫很简单,没有想象中那么难,也许所有学问都是这样,恐惧源自于无知。废话不多说,现在开始我们的爬虫之旅吧。 爬虫是什么? 我们时常听说编程大牛嘴边一直念叨着“网络爬虫“,那网络爬虫究竟是何方神圣呢? 网络爬虫能够模仿用户浏览网页,并将所想要的页面中的信息保存下来。有些同学不禁要问:“我自己浏览网页,可以手动将数据保存下来啊,为何要写个程序去爬取数据呢?“道理其实很简单,程序能够在短时间内访问成千上万的页面,并且在短时间内将海量数据保存下来,这速度可远远超越了

    07
    领券